Waleed Asghar is a scholar working on Plant Science, Soil Science and Agronomy and Crop Science. According to data from OpenAlex, Waleed Asghar has authored 17 papers receiving a total of 178 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 12 papers in Plant Science, 4 papers in Soil Science and 3 papers in Agronomy and Crop Science. Recurrent topics in Waleed Asghar’s work include Plant-Microbe Interactions and Immunity (8 papers), Nematode management and characterization studies (6 papers) and Legume Nitrogen Fixing Symbiosis (3 papers). Waleed Asghar is often cited by papers focused on Plant-Microbe Interactions and Immunity (8 papers), Nematode management and characterization studies (6 papers) and Legume Nitrogen Fixing Symbiosis (3 papers). Waleed Asghar collaborates with scholars based in Japan, Pakistan and United States. Waleed Asghar's co-authors include Ryota Kataoka, Ahmad Mahmood, Jing Huang, Xiaojun Shi, Yongmei Xu, Huimin Zhang, Waqas Ahmed, Hongzhu Fan, Muhammad Qaswar and Muhammad Sohaib Asghar and has published in prestigious journals such as PLoS ONE, International Journal of Molecular Sciences and Plant and Soil.
